[REQUEST] Lenovo Yoga 2.11 whitelist removal
Ok friend,
The best thing is to get the Tools to get free (SPI Programmer + Clip) but
We can try before this trick :

0x21067    Setting: LPSS SPI Support, Variable: 0x163
0x2108D     Option: Disabled, Value: 0x0
0x210A9     Option: Enabled, Value: 0x1
0x210C5    End of Options

0x2179D Setting: BIOS Read/Write Protection, Variable: 0x1FC
0x217C3 Option: Enabled, Value: 0x1
0x217DF Option: Disabled, Value: 0x0 (default)
0x217FB End of Options

0x21A25     Setting: TXE HMRFPO , Variable: 0x170
0x21A4B      Option: Disabled, Value: 0x0 (default)
0x21A67      Option: Enabled, Value: 0x1
0x21A83     End of Options


With the above, how would one amend these in a hex editor?
find
quote
It's not to apply on Bios file but just to set into Hi-Mem Protected (NVRAM Emulation) so
only writing by FlaseClock Method is possible !
